Step back in time on the Santa Maria de Colombo Sailing Tour in Madeira, Portugal, as you board a remarkable replica of Christopher Columbus’s iconic vessel. Departing from Funchal, this immersive experience invites you to relive the spirit of the 15th century while exploring the island’s stunning southern coastline.
The journey takes you along Madeira’s lush, dramatic shores, offering panoramic views of the Atlantic and the island’s rich landscape. As the ship glides toward Cabo Girão, one of Europe’s highest sea cliffs, you’ll feel the thrill of adventure and the tranquility of the open sea, all from the deck of this historic reconstruction.
At Cabo Girão, the captain anchors the ship, providing a fantastic opportunity to swim in the crystal-clear waters just off the coast. Whether you choose to dive in or simply relax on deck, the refreshing Atlantic breeze and breathtaking scenery make this stop a true highlight of the tour.
Throughout the cruise, keep your eyes peeled for playful dolphins and majestic whales that often surface near the vessel. The knowledgeable crew share fascinating stories about Columbus’s voyages and Madeira’s maritime heritage, making this trip as educational as it is captivating.
The tour lasts approximately three hours and includes your spot on the Santa Maria replica. Food, drinks, and transportation to the meeting point in Funchal are not included. Spaces fill quickly for this memorable journey into history, so check availability and book your sailing adventure today!
